Output e38822f076548c3e30b366627f968ec96cefc9e7a736736d507c1c3115139a63:21

value
5740546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93d03ed31f5eed7ead38f16987d9aedcdde13c39 OP_EQUALVERIFY OP_CHECKSIG
address
1EUZoLwNS3WrngkUy9WsxHnseDZADAWdeS
transaction
e38822f076548c3e30b366627f968ec96cefc9e7a736736d507c1c3115139a63
spent
true